LOOK2014 gala, Calgary

The art community isn’t often abuzz with news of a major merger, but that’s exactly what happened in Calgary last January when three institutions – the Art Gallery of Calgary, the Museum of Modern and Contemporary Art and the Institute of Modern and Contemporary Art – joined together as one mega gallery, Contemporary Calgary. On Nov. 1, the organization hosted a fundraiser, LOOK2014, in its future home, a brutalist 1967 building that was once the Centennial Planetarium. Honorary chairs Morris and Ann Dancyger, Mark Tewksbury and Rob Mabee welcomed some 600 guests, including author and urban studies theorist Richard Florida, who spoke with television personality Dave Kelly in front of a VIP crowd. Meanwhile, local artist David Brunning worked on his latest creation, giving guests an inside look at the process of making contemporary art. The event helped raise $500,000 to support the gallery’s goal of engaging the city with boundary-pushing art.

Aquazzura luncheon, Vancouver

“Women shouldn’t count years or pairs of shoes,” quipped Edgardo Osorio, the designer behind Italian shoe label Aquazzura, who was in Canada recently for a cross-country shoe-athon with Holt Renfrew. The Florencebased Central Saint Martins alumnus did time at Salvatore Ferragamo and Roberto Cavalli before branching out on his own in 2011. Since then, Aquazzura shoes have become favourites of footwear fanatics the world over, including globe-trotting style star Olivia Palermo, Spanish best-dressed-list-topper Nati Abascal and Vancouver socialite Manjy Sidoo. Wearing Oscar de la Renta, Sidoo hosted an intimate luncheon for Osorio at the Vancouver home she shares with her husband, CFL player turned stockbroker David Sidoo. Also on hand for the midday meal: Irene Fernandes, Joelle Stanbridge and Aquazzura PR pro Ricardo Figueiredo.
